64 Mile Camp (Jahek)_ in context
With 264 people at the 2011 Census, 64 Mile Camp (Jahek)_ was the 71st most populous of its district's 283 villages, above the district average of 240.
Literacy stood at 72.17%, 7.8 points above the district's rural average of 64.37%.
The sex ratio was 970 women per 1,000 men (171 above the district's rural figure of 799).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1833, 910 above the rural national 923.
